REMOTE-CONTROLLED UNMANNED UNDERWATER VEHICLE Russian patent published in 2024 - IPC B63C11/48 B63G8/00 

Abstract RU 2829517 C1

FIELD: underwater equipment.

SUBSTANCE: invention relates to underwater equipment, in particular to remotely controlled unmanned underwater vehicles (RCUUV) for sea or river purpose. Remote-controlled unmanned underwater vehicle contains a sealed hollow body with installed propellers and a buoyancy module connected to each other by a screw joint. Buoyancy module comprises interconnected casing, side panels and side walls, and floats of rigid closed-cell polyurethane foam arranged in buoyancy module correspond to its internal shape. In buoyancy module casing and side walls there are drain holes. Apparatus is equipped with a communication cable, a LED deep-sea lantern and a video camera. Body of the apparatus is made of PLA plastic and has the shape of a parallelepiped. Buoyancy module casing, side panels and side walls are rigidly connected to each other. Apparatus uses vector-based propulsors directed at angle of 90° in relation to each other in horizontal and vertical planes, on the front wall of the housing of the apparatus, in the lower part, an electromechanical single-stage manipulator is installed and rigidly fixed for gripping the objects of study, comprising a metal housing, a movable two-fingered gripper, a rod and an electric motor, connected in series, and a water sampling system comprising a housing, suction branch pipes connected to a system of pipelines, water collectors and a pump and rigidly connected to the housing of the system. On the front wall of the vehicle body there rigidly fixed is a LED deep-sea lantern and a video camera, and a communication cable is rigidly fixed on the rear wall of the body of the vehicle.

EFFECT: high efficiency of using the device and wider range of its application.
